A credit card issuer might notify a credit reporting agency that it wants to advertise new credit card products and desires to purchase a mailing list of consumers who meet a predetermined list of credit selection criteria. Here is how the prescreening process works. The 3 major credit reporting agencies ( Equifax, TransUnion, and Experian) are permitted under the Fair Credit Reporting Act (FCRA) to sell lenders mailing lists of consumers who meet certain credit standards. Outriders operates on DLSS 2.0, however, which is Nvidia's second major attempt at nailing AI-powered upscaling, and it has been very successful in doing just that. You're sacrificing clarity and detail for speed with every notch towards performance you get. There are a couple of settings to choose from: Quality, Balanced, Performance, Ultra-Performance. In our case, it's the key to high frame rates in Outriders on compatible cards. It's a feature included with modern Nvidia graphics cards, of the RTX 20-series and 30-series, and uses machine learning to upscale any given frame.
